What are the cheapest cars to buy?
The cheapest car isn't just about the purchase price: it's about how affordable it is to run. Fuel efficiency, insurance costs, and maintenance expenses all play a big role in keeping ownership costs down.

How can I get a good cheap car?
Finding a great car at a low price starts with having the right information. At MOTORS, every car goes through an HPI check before being listed, so you can see key details like whether it's been stolen, scrapped, imported, exported, written off, or even had a colour change. These results are clearly displayed on each vehicle listing for added peace of mind*.
Our listings also provide essential details such as mileage, range, insurance group to help you make an informed decision.
Most sellers are happy to arrange a test drive, which is a crucial step to ensure the car runs smoothly and meets your expectations. You can easily set this up directly with the seller before making your decision.
*Always confirm the vehicle history details with the seller and consider getting a professional inspection for extra reassurance before buying.
